Understanding Compatibility Between LED Bulbs and Incandescent Fixtures

When considering the use⁣ of LED bulbs in incandescent fixtures,‍ it’s essential⁢ to understand that ‍these two technologies operate⁣ differently.LED⁤ bulbs are designed‍ to be energy-efficient ⁤and convert a higher⁤ percentage of energy into​ light,​ while ‍incandescent ⁤bulbs waste a significant portion of their ⁤energy as heat.Fortunately,⁣ most LED bulbs are compatible with traditional⁤ incandescent fixtures, allowing for ​a seamless ‌upgrade without requiring⁣ a redesign ⁢of your lighting system. Though, you​ may​ encounter issues if⁤ the‍ fixture is dimmable, as⁣ not all LED options are compatible ⁢with⁢ dimmer switches.

To ensure​ a prosperous transition from incandescent to LED,⁣ keep ⁢the following points in mind:

  • Wattage: Ensure that⁣ the LED​ bulb’s wattage matches or is ⁢lower ‌than that of the⁢ incandescent bulb it replaces.
  • Shape and ⁣Size: ‌Check that the bulb’s shape fits the fixture without⁣ obstruction.
  • Dimming Capability: If using dimmers, choose LED ​bulbs specifically labeled as compatible with dimmable fixtures.
  • color Temperature: ⁣ Select a color temperature that matches the ‌atmosphere you want to create.

Addressing Common Concerns and Myths About ⁢LED ‍Upgrades

Many people ⁣hesitate ⁢to ‍upgrade to LED ‍light bulbs due to​ misconceptions about compatibility and performance.One common concern is the belief that LED ​bulbs produce a ‍harsh, cold light, while incandescent bulbs provide a warm and inviting glow. However, advancements ‍in‍ LED technology have⁤ introduced a variety of‍ color temperatures, allowing users to⁢ choose from ‌options⁢ that ‌replicate the ‍familiar‍ warmth of traditional incandescent fixtures.Choosing the⁤ right LED bulb ​can create a cozy atmosphere without compromising⁣ on energy⁢ efficiency. Other concerns include‍ flickering or buzzing​ when using LED ⁣bulbs in older fixtures, which​ can frequently enough be addressed by ⁤selecting compatible bulbs ⁢or using dimmer​ switches specifically designed for LED technology.

Another myth revolves around ‍the idea ‌that inverting the ⁤shape or size of an incandescent fixture when⁤ using leds can lead to issues. In‌ reality,LED bulbs are designed to fit⁤ standard sockets⁤ and come in various shapes,allowing them to ⁢function seamlessly in most settings. While it’s ⁢essential to consider the wattage ⁤and voltage specifications of ⁤both the fixture⁣ and the⁣ LED bulb,using LEDs can significantly ⁣lower ‍energy consumption and extend the lifespan of your lighting. Practical ⁣Tips ‌for Switching to LED in Existing ‌Lighting Systems

Making the transition to LED lighting ‍in ‍your existing fixtures ​can significantly enhance energy‌ efficiency while providing remarkable illumination.‍ Here are⁢ some practical tips to ensure a smooth switch:

  • Compatibility Check: Before purchasing LED ⁣bulbs, verify that they are compatible with your fixtures, especially if they⁤ have dimming capabilities.
  • Wattage Consideration: Choose LED bulbs that match or are lower​ than the wattage of your original incandescent‌ bulbs to prevent any potential overheating.
  • light⁢ Color ‍Selection: ⁤ Consider the color temperature ⁤of the​ LED⁤ light (measured in Kelvin)‌ to ⁢achieve ⁢the desired ambiance –‍ warm ‍white (2700K)⁤ is great ⁣for a cozy feel.
  • Fixture Type: Assess the ‌type of fixture you have; some recessed or enclosed fixtures may require specialized ⁣LED bulbs to avoid ​damage.

Q&A:‌ can I Put LED Light Bulbs in an Incandescent Fixture?

Q: What​ is an ⁢incandescent ⁢fixture?

A:‍ An incandescent fixture⁣ is a light fixture designed ​to hold traditional incandescent light⁢ bulbs,⁢ which produce light‍ by heating‍ a filament. These​ fixtures are⁣ commonly found in homes and​ may or may not have specific wattage limits.


Q: Can I replace my incandescent bulbs‌ with LED bulbs in‌ these ‍fixtures?

A:‍ Absolutely!⁤ LED ‍bulbs are designed to fit into standard light fixtures, including those meant‍ for incandescent ​bulbs. Provided that the base type,⁢ like E26 or‍ E12, ​is compatible, you ‍can easily swap⁣ an LED bulb for an incandescent one.


Q: Will using ‌LED bulbs in these fixtures dim the light?

A: Not at all!⁤ In fact, ​LED​ bulbs are ⁢often​ brighter than their ‌incandescent counterparts, using significantly ‍less ‌power.However, it’s essential to choose an LED bulb with the right lumens (brightness) ‍to match your lighting needs.


Q:⁣ Are there any concerns​ regarding heat with ⁢LED ⁣bulbs in incandescent fixtures?

A:⁤ One of ⁣the perks⁢ of LED⁢ bulbs is their low heat ⁤output.Unlike incandescent bulbs that⁢ emit a ⁤lot of heat,LEDs stay ⁢cool to the touch,reducing the risk of heat-related⁢ damage to the fixture or‍ surrounding materials.


Q:‌ Do I need ‌to worry about compatibility with ⁢dimmer ‌switches?

A:⁤ if your incandescent fixture is connected⁣ to a dimmer switch, ⁣it’s crucial ​to use dimmable LED bulbs. Not all LEDs are compatible with⁤ dimmers, which could lead to flickering or reduced performance. Check the ‌packaging for compatibility, and consider upgrading⁤ your dimmer if necessary.


Q: What advantages do LED ‍bulbs have over incandescent bulbs?

A: ​LED ‌bulbs‌ are more energy-efficient, lasting up to 25 times longer than incandescent ⁣bulbs. This means⁤ you’ll save on⁢ energy bills and reduce the frequency of replacements—making them a more sustainable choice overall.

Q: Can I mix and match LED bulbs with incandescent bulbs in the⁢ same fixture?

A:⁣ It’s ​generally advisable to use the same ​type ⁣of‍ bulb in a fixture for consistent lighting and⁢ performance. Mixing can result in uneven illumination and potentially compromise the lifespan of your bulbs.


Q: What about​ flickering issues with ​LED bulbs?

A: Flickering⁣ can occur due to incompatible dimmer switches, poor-quality‍ bulbs, or wiring issues. ⁤If ⁢you experience flickering with your LEDs, try switching‌ to a different brand or a ‍compatible dimmer, or ​consult an electrician for further ‌diagnosis.
